Route 114.
A unique scent, a mixture of sulfur and dust, permeated the air.
Volcanic ash drifting down from Mt. Chimney, like never-ending tiny particles of dust, cast a faint gray layer over the entire world.
The soil beneath his feet was a dull reddish-brown, a testament to thousands of years of volcanic mineral deposits.
Ariel walked across this land with steady steps, without a single wasted movement.
His goal was clear—Fallarbor Town.
But traveling wasn't the only purpose.
This road was the best natural training ground for his team.
"Froa!"
A wild Zigzagoon got a face full of bubbles; its vision obscured, its movements instantly became sluggish.
A second later, a blue shadow shot out like a bolt of electricity.
Froakie's figure flashed past the Zigzagoon's side, trailing a streak of white light.
Quick Attack.
The Zigzagoon's eyes rolled back as it completely lost the ability to battle.
"Well done."
Ariel recalled Froakie, his tone flat.
From leaving Rustboro City until now, the wild Pokémon on this road were of low levels, serving as perfect experience fodder for Froakie.
After successive battles, its movements had become increasingly swift, and its timing much more precise.
"Froakie, Level 15, Ability: Protean..."
The pokédex emitted a cold notification sound.
Ariel's gaze fell on Froakie; the little fellow was wiping its cheek with its hind leg, its eyes showing a bit more spark.
Not bad, very efficient.
It had gained two levels along the way, and was now just one step away from evolving at Level 16.
Continuing forward, a sudden, rapid rustling sound came from the bushes ahead.
A sturdy Zangoose lunged out, its sharp claws flashing with a cold glint in the dim light. Upon seeing Ariel, it immediately struck an aggressive pose, letting out a threatening low growl from its throat.
"Malamar."
Ariel softly spoke the name.
In a flash of light, the bizarrely shaped Malamar hovered in mid-air, its eight tentacles moving of their own accord despite the lack of wind, its yellow and black eyes fixed intently on the opponent.
That Zangoose was clearly no pushover; seeing its opponent appear, it didn't retreat but instead advanced, crossing its claws in front of its chest and performing a strange dance.
Swords Dance!
A sharp aura erupted from it, its attack power skyrocketing at a visible rate.
Ariel didn't order an interruption, simply watching quietly.
He wanted to see where this Malamar's limits lay.
Once Swords Dance finished, the Zangoose's momentum reached its peak. It let out a shrill shriek and transformed into an afterimage, lunging straight for Malamar!
"Contrary."
Ariel finally spoke, uttering two words.
The yellow light in Malamar's eyes intensified, and an invisible, eerie force instantly enveloped the charging Zangoose.
The Zangoose, in the middle of its high-speed charge, suddenly stiffened. It felt the explosive power within its body drain away like a bursting dam, replaced by an unprecedented sense of weakness.
The sharp aura on its body instantly withered.
The originally staggering attack power boost had been forcefully inverted into a massive reduction by the move 'Contrary'!
"Psycho Cut." Ariel's voice rang out again.
Malamar pointed a tentacle, and a powerful psychic slash slammed into the weakened Zangoose. The latter didn't even have time to scream before being sent flying, crashing into the dark red soil, motionless.
A one-hit KO.
Ariel's eyes lit up.
"Contrary... interesting."
He murmured to himself.
This move was a new addition to Malamar's arsenal.
It was practically the nemesis of all stat-boosting playstyles. Whether it was Swords Dance, Dragon Dance, or Nasty Plot, they would all become gifts for the opponent in the face of this move.
In high-end matches in the future, this would definitely be a trump card capable of instantly turning the tide of battle.
The team's strength had improved once more.
Ariel continued forward and came to a stop beneath a rock wall.
According to the pokédex's detection, something seemed to be hidden in the crevices of this rock face.
"Sneasel."
With a flash of red light, the agile Sneasel appeared before the rock wall.
"Cut it open."
Receiving the command, Sneasel swung its sharp claws without hesitation.
"Swish! Swish! Swish!"
Claw shadows flew, and the hard volcanic rock was sliced open as easily as tofu before it, sending stone fragments scattering.
While cutting through a particularly hard piece of ore, Sneasel's claws suddenly paused.
A silvery-white metallic luster condensed without warning at the tips of its claws, and an unstoppable aura emanated from them.
The next moment, it swung its claws again!
"Clang!"
With a crisp sound like metal clashing, that hard ore split apart, the cut as smooth as a mirror.
Ariel looked at Sneasel's metal-glistening claws and understood.
This was a new gain for Sneasel, Metal Claw, which nicely increased its coverage.
As for Krokorok, the big brother of the team, its growth was even more stable.
In a battle against a wild Sandslash, it relied on its great strength and Moxie ability to forcefully raise its level by two, reaching Level 33.
Meanwhile, Malamar and Sneasel's levels had also increased by one.
The entire team's strength had undergone a significant transformation on the way to Fallarbor Town.
Just as Ariel was immersed in the joy of his team's increased strength, several young voices came from behind him.
"Hey! Brother up ahead, wait for us!"
Ariel turned back to see three youths around his age catching up, panting. They carried travel bags, were accompanied by an Oddish and a Skitty, and wore warm, simple smiles.
"Hello."
Ariel stopped, his attitude neither hot nor cold.
"Hello, hello! I'm A Cheng, and these are A-Ming and A-Liang."
The lead youth introduced himself cheerfully. "We're Trainers from Fallarbor Town. From the looks of it, you're heading there too, right?"
"Yeah."
Ariel nodded.
Information was arriving.
"Great! We can just walk together!"
A Cheng seemed very happy.
"Brother, are you traveling alone? That's amazing! Your Pokémon look really strong!"
"They're alright."
Ariel was concise.
The group soon became acquainted—or rather, the three youths became acquainted with Ariel unilaterally.
They chattered all the way, talking about the Contest in Fallarbor Town, where the best berries nearby were, and the newly opened Battle Tent in town.
"Speaking of which, things haven't been very peaceful around town lately."
A-Ming suddenly lowered his voice. "I heard from my dad that several Trainers' Pokémon have gone missing. They suspect those despicable Pokémon Hunters are behind it!"
"Pokémon Hunters?"
A Cheng was immediately filled with righteous indignation.
"Those scumbags! They'll do anything for money! If I run into them, I'll definitely have my Charmeleon burn them to ash!"
"Exactly! Pokémon are our partners, how can they be bought and sold!" A-Liang chimed in.
Listening to their righteous condemnation, Ariel added a comment:
"That group is indeed despicable."
But his heart remained unmoved.
From their conversation, Ariel also confirmed the information he needed—there was a newly opened 'Battle Tent' in Fallarbor Town.
This was likely the key entry point for his objective on this trip.
He bid farewell to the three enthusiastic youths at the entrance to Fallarbor Town.
